airMAX 60 GHz/5 GHz Radio with 1+ Gbps throughput and up to 2 km range.
Featuring a high-gain dish antenna, the GigaBeam LR is an airMAX 60 GHz radio designed for low-interference And high-throughput connectivity of up to 1+ Gbps in long-range deployments of up to 2 km. The GigaBeam LR includes a 5 GHz radio for 60GHz link failover. Easy setup can be done via UISP app.
